Jennifer Manley

Jennifer Manley will take over as the Marywood University men's and women's diving coach for the 2019-20 season. Manley holds a dual coaching position with both the Pacers and University of Scranton. 

Manley began as the Royals' diving coach in 2018, overseeing the Landmark Conference men's 1- and 3-meter diving champion. She is also the diving coach at Abington Heights High School. 

She returned back to coaching after serving as the Council Rock diving coach in the 2000s. 

Manley is a former Division I diver at Rider University in Lawrenceville, New Jersey. With the Broncos, she earned Silver Athletic Academic Awards three times. 

In addition to coaching, she serves as an Educational Coach and Coordinator for Scranton Lackawanna Human Development Agency (SLHDA) Head Start, overseeing practice-based coaching, supervision, and monitoring of 11 early education classrooms.

Manley holds a Bachelor of Science degree in elementary education and English writing from Rider University. She holds professional certifications in Elementary Education from New Jersey and Pennsylvania. She resides in Scranton.
